Charlton House wins Mansion House catering contract

4th January 2010, 10:29am

Charlton House has been awarded the most prized catering contract in the City - the Mansion House.

Under an initial three-year contract, the independent caterers will take over on 1st February, and will cater for their first Mayoral Banquet on 11th February. In addition, Charlton House will provide private catering services to the Lord Mayor, Lady Mayoress and family.

Mansion House is the private residence of the Lord Mayor, the Lady Mayoress and their family, a base for the Lord Mayor's Office and a department of the City of London Corporation.

Alison Tyler, managing director of Charlton House, said: "Having made the strategic decision in 2007 to enter the highly competitive City of London livery sector, this achievement is far beyond our expectations. We could never have imagined at that time winning such a prestigious contract so soon.

"To be chosen as caterers to the Mansion House is a remarkable testament to the excellent team of people within our business and to Charlton House's continuous delivery of outstanding food and service standards throughout the City and beyond."
